Keyless Entry
Many modern cars come with key fobs which allow owners to unlock and start their vehicle without the need of inserting a physical key into the ignition barrel. These keys have a transponder that transmits a cryptic message to the car. Only when the signal is received correctly can the vehicle begin to move.
Certain key fobs are equipped with a number of features that owners may not be aware of but could prove useful in the event of. There are a few things you could do if the citroen's key fob isn't working. It could be due to a dropped object that has damaged the internal chip or it could have simply stopped working.
You should first check the battery of your key fob. A lot of the issues mentioned above are caused by an insufficient or dead key fob battery. It can stop the key fob from sending signals to the receiver module in the vehicle. It is simple to replace the battery at home. Check for any water damage to the key fob, as this could also cause it to cease functioning. Once you have replaced the battery, reconnecting the key fob into the ignition could help restore its functionality. It is a good idea also to test the lock and unlock functions of each buttons on the key fob.

The key fob's warning symbol for battery on your dashboard could indicate that the batteries inside the key fob have very low levels. The batteries will have to be replaced. It is easy to do and can even be done while driving. The majority of keys can be opened to let replacement key for citroen berlingo van batteries to be inserted. Most electronics stores stock the CR2025 and CR2032 3-Volt batteries. Look in your owner's manual for details or YouTube videos on how to do this.
